GERMANTOWN, Tenn. – The Automotive Distribution Network continues to expand on the West Coast with the signing of Portland-based IPD USA.

“I’m pleased to welcome the country’s foremost Volvo specialists to the Network under the Auto Pride brand,” said Mike Lambert, president of the Network.

This most recent addition to Auto Pride reflects the brand’s ongoing plan to sign parts distributors with potential for growth, according to Cora Roark, director of Auto Pride. “Auto Pride continues to sign niche warehouses that are an ideal fit for the brand,” Roark said. “The Network will be a strong ally as IPD expands and adds product lines.”

Since 1963, IPD has focused on OE and custom-made Volvo parts, including its own 4T4 ball-bearing turbocharger, shipping orders worldwide via their in-house online store.

“The Network’s relationships with top-tier vendors are second to none, so Auto Pride will be a great resource for us as we continue to push the boundaries of our Volvo business,” said Stuart Hockman, president of IPD USA. “With the recent launch of our new subsidiary, WPD USA, the timing was right to join the Network as we are in the process of adding several import-car product lines, including Subaru, VW, Audi and Saab.”
